'John Harrison and the Quest for Longitude', in a revised and updated edition, is a fascinating account of the life and achievements of the man who designed and built the first accurate marine chronometers. Inspired by the prize offered in 1714 to provide a solution to the problem of determining longitudinal position at sea, John Harrison - a carpenter by trade - set out to develop portable clocks that would rival even the most precise watches of the time. This book tells the story of one man driven by the need to solve one of the greatest practical problems of his time.
